:: This is part of our Interview series where we interview top people in the Haunted House/Horror Business Indistry::

Why did you first become interested in the Haunted House/Horror Business?
It all started with a B movie. A low budget horror film morphed into Phobia, a 30 acre site with five separate haunted attractions and 150+ employees. Then we started producing our own animatronics and props. We never made the movie, but we do scare tens of thousands of patrons every season, here in Houston. We sell our props throughout the U.S., Canada, and Latin America, via Phobiaprops.com.

cyber rig.jpg

What previous jobs have you had?
I have been a loose diamond buyer, developed real estate, raised cattle and, of course, this is Texas, there’s always the oil patch.

What job do you do right now? Is the Haunted House/Horror Job your full time gig?
Phobia and Phobiaprops,com is a year round effort, employing several full time artisans.
I have other ongoing investments, but the Haunted House business rules all.

VERSIPELLIS is the new, independent documentary about werewolfism. As seen from a classic European perspective, it ranges from historical cases to modern theories, from wolves behavior to legends and folklore, mental deseases and more. VERSIPELLIS is going to be a milestone in its field: a 50 minutes feature documentary freely downloadable (in 5 blocks), enriched with interviews with many experts in the field of zoology, legends, medicine, criminology.

VERSIPELLIS is an international non-profit project, and its revenues will be donated to wolf conservation project(s).
The documentary is co-produced by Italian directors Michele Cogliati and Francesco Cortonesi in association with filmhorror.com (Italy) and monstruous.com(U.K.). The whole script is based on historical research, European legends and lore, psychiatric and criminological profiles, to offer the most complete full immersion in the darkness of the werewolf's mith.

Being a non-profit project, producers encourage private donations and industry sponsorships to support the process: "But we will carefully evaluate their history and position regarding wildlife respect and conservation policies". With the help from credited sites and communities devoted to wildlife conservation and horror movies, VERSIPELLIS' aim is to explore a new frontier in entertainment offering a rich and informative movie while supporting wildlife conservation.

VERSIPELLIS is the ancient Latin term for "werewolf", the most fearsome and most southern monstrous creature ever. A small clip is available for free download just to show the spirit of the documentary. Nothing is definitive at this stage but we hope you will like our style.
